merge from branch stable-succint-jumping
[SXSI/xpathcomp.git] / options.ml
index bd7fcce..ab25d7d 100644 (file)
@@ -7,7 +7,7 @@ let input_file = ref ""
 let output_file = ref None
 let save_file = ref ""
 let count_only = ref false
-
+let time = ref false
 
 let usage_msg = Printf.sprintf "%s <input.{xml|srx}> 'query' [output]" Sys.argv.(0)
 
@@ -20,7 +20,8 @@ let anon_fun =
     | 2 -> output_file := Some s; incr pos
     | _ -> raise (Arg.Bad(s))
 
-let spec = [ "-c", Arg.Set(count_only), "counting only (don't materialize the result set";
+let spec = [ "-c", Arg.Set(count_only), "counting only (don't materialize the result set)";
+            "-t", Arg.Set(time), "print timing statistics";
              "-f", Arg.Set_int(sample_factor), "sample factor [default=64]";
             "-i", Arg.Set(index_empty_texts), "index empty texts [default=false]";
             "-d", Arg.Set(disable_text_collection), "disable text collection[default=false]";